Cold dishes of the Universe

This image shows three antennas ("dishes"), part of the Atacama Large Millimetre/submillimetre Array (ALMA) in a snowy setting. ALMA will be composed initially of 66 high precision antennas located on the Chajnantor plateau, 5000 metres altitude in northern Chile.

ALMA observes light emitted by cool-temperature objects in space, which permits us to unravel profound mysteries about the formation of planets and the appearance of complex molecules, including organic molecules.
